>> checkin with -ko.
>
> yes but is not selective; it applies to all files.
It applies to files given as arguments. So, at the initial checkin you just
have to make a separate checkin for the files you want to turn off
substitution. E.g.
cvs add myfile1 myfile2 ...
cvs add -ko myfileWithouSubstitution1 myfileWithouSubstitution2 ...
cvs add -kb myBinary1 myBinary2 ...
Because this had to be done just once (initial checkin), where's the
problem?
